Debenhams

Debenhams is one of the UK's oldest department stores. Its history dates to 1778, when William Clark opened a draper's store in Wigmore Street. In 1813, Clark partnered up with Suffolk businessman William Debenham and the store was changed to Clark & Debenham.

The company was once a top British retailer however, vimeo.Com in recent times it has been lagging behind its competitors. In March of 2020 it went into administration for the first time. A group of investors purchased the company and it has resumed trading. The chain operates 178 stores in the UK and Ireland.

In the early 1980s, Debenhams was taken over by the Burton Group. It regained its independence in 1998 when it was demerged from the parent company and listed on the London Stock Exchange. In this time it underwent major changes and introduced exclusive products and brands such as Designers at Debenhams. It also bought the Danish group of department stores Magasin Du Nord.
